Mexico's Ciudad del Carmen Airport Thrives as Energy and Tourism Hub

Carmen City International Airport, located in Carmen City, Campeche, Mexico, is a significant civil airport mainly serving the oil industry in the Gulf of Mexico. Covering an area of 192 hectares, it features a 2200-meter runway suitable for various commercial aircraft. Although services are somewhat limited, the airport connects to Mexico City and some cities in the United States. From 2013 to 2014, there was a notable increase in passenger traffic, highlighting its importance within the regional air transportation network.

Saudi Arabia Expands Aviation Sector with New Airline, IATA Hub

The Saudi Arabian government has announced that the International Air Transport Association will establish a regional office in Riyadh to meet the growing demands of the industry. Additionally, plans are underway to launch a new flagship airline aimed at transforming Saudi Arabia into a global logistics hub, enhancing economic diversification, and reducing reliance on oil. The new airline is expected to increase the number of international routes significantly and boost air cargo capacity, with an anticipated ranking as the fifth largest in global air transit volume.

Analysis of the Plight of China's International Shipping Industry Amidst Weak Foreign Trade

The global shipping industry is facing severe challenges, with China's international shipping market impacted by economic fluctuations leading to reduced exports of manufactured goods and imports of resources. The depreciation of the yuan has not significantly boosted exports, and there is a serious oversupply of vessels amid low market demand, particularly affecting dry bulk and container shipping. Although the oil tanker manufacturing sector has shifted towards energy-efficient ships, it faces competitive pressures due to fuel price volatility. The winter for global shipping extends beyond China, necessitating urgent industry and market structural adjustments.
